Cox Group announces intention to float on the Spanish Stock Exchanges

  • The successful start of the process and the strong interest shown by strategic, financial and institutional investors supports the Company’s timetable for the IPO 
  • AMEA Power and Corporación Cunext are strategic investors that have signed binding commitments
  • Existing shareholders, Alberto Zardoya and Enrique Riquelme, have as well signed binding commitments, confirming their support to the primary capital offering.
  • Attijariwafa Bank and other financial investors have as well confirmed their participation in the offering.

 

Madrid, Spain, 14th October 2024 – Cox, utility of water and energy, announces today that, following confirmation last week of its intention to proceed with an initial public offering of its ordinary shares to qualified investors, it has received binding commitments from cornerstone investors, representing approximately 30% of the total offer, including the following:

• AMEA Power
• Corporación Cunext
• Alberto Zardoya
• Enrique Riquelme

Additionally, Attijariwafa Bank and other financial investors have confirmed their participation in the offering.

All of the above is subject to the approval of the prospectus by CNMV and in the case of Attijariwafa Bank, compliance with applicable internal regulations and approval processes, as well as domestic law.

AMEA Power is one of the fastest growing renewable energy companies in the Middle East, Africa and Asia region with a clean energy pipeline of over 6GW across 20 countries 1 , strong track record and excellent positioning in the region.

Attijariwafa Bank is the first financial group of Morocco. It is part of the Al Mada Group, one of the largest private equity funds in Africa, which invests in structuring business sectors that require a high level of capital intensity, such as banking & insurance, retail, mining & construction materiales, energy & telecommunications, real estate & tourism, and others.

Corporación Cunext is one of the most relevant Spanish industrial groups and a leading supplier of processed copper and aluminium products in Southern Europe and North West Africa.

Alberto Zardoya is a renowned Spanish businessman and a shareholder of Cox since its beginnings.

Enrique Riquelme is the founder of Cox and main shareholder of the company. Through the investment, he confirms his confidence and commitment to the business in the long term, as well as his maximum commitment to the company’s growth plan.

The Offering will consist of a primary offering of newly issued Shares by the Company, targeting an equity raise of approximately up to €270 million (excluding over-allotment option). The Offering will be made to qualified investors, including a placement in the United States to qualified institutional buyers under Rule 144A.

Further details of the proposed Offering will be included in the Prospectus to be approved by, and registered with, the Spanish Securities Market Commission (Comisión Nacional del Mercado de Valores, the “CNMV”) in connection with the Offering and the Admission, and which will supersede this announcement in its entirety. The Prospectus approval process is ongoing and will include full details on the Offering and its expected timetable. Once approved, the Prospectus will be published and made available at the Company’s website (www.grupocox.com), in subsection IPO, and at the CNMV’s website (www.cnmv.es).

Any acquisition of Shares in the Company should be made solely on the basis of the Prospectus approved by, and registered with, the CNMV. The approval of the Prospectus by the CNMV does not constitute an evaluation of the merits of the Offering.

Luis Arizaga Zárate

Independent Director

Member of the Audit Committee

Date of appointment: September 17, 2024

Shareholding in Cox Abg Group, S.A.: 11,514 shares

Partner of Exus Management Partners (Exus) and GenuX Power, a global renewable energy platform with offices in nine countries, managing 11GW of installed capacity, including 2.6GW in Mexico between wind and solar energy projects. Holds a Master of Business Administration (MBA) from the Leonard N. Stern School of Business at NYU in New York, and a bachelors degree in Accounting and Finance from ITESM in Mexico.

Prior to joining EXUS in 2019, he founded EIRA Capital, an investment platform focused on Energy and Infrastructure transactions in Mexico, and Latin America. He was also part of Australia’s Macquarie Group in Latin America, where he spent more than 7 years in the Macquarie Capital and Macquarie Funds divisions, working on fund capital raising, equity investments, asset management activities, as well as third party advisory roles on energy and infrastructure transactions in Mexico and Latin America. During his years at Macquarie, he also held board positions in the several investments made by Macquarie which covered energy, public private partnerships, roads, and telecom companies. In addition, his previous involvement at financial institutions include positions in the investment banking teams of Deutsche Bank’s M&A group in New York, and Citibank’s M&A group in Mexico.

Other former relevant positions include his role as independent member of the investment committee of the Instituto del Fondo Nacional de la Vivienda para los Trabajadores (Mexican mortgages and housing government agency).

Enrique Riquelme Vives

Presidente Ejecutivo

Fecha de nombramiento: 17 de septiembre de 2024

Participación en el capital social de Cox Abg Group, S.A.: 50.612.744  acciones

Presidente Ejecutivo de Cox, tras iniciar su andadura profesional en el sector inmobiliario y de la construcción, en 2010 fundó Grupo El Sol en Panamá, especializado en operaciones de minería, cemento, infraestructuras y energía. Con el tiempo, la empresa se convertiría en el mayor proveedor de arena de la UTE responsable de la ampliación del canal de Panamá. Posteriormente, pasó a liderar las fases de oferta y desarrollo de Rainbow 50: el proyecto fotovoltaico de mayor envergadura ejecutado en América Latina hasta aquel momento.

Ha recibido varios galardones por su contribución al mundo empresarial en España, entre ellos el Premio del Certamen Nacional de Jóvenes Emprendedores 2018. También ha sido distinguido como uno de los «100 latinos más influyentes comprometidos con la acción climática» y uno de los «100 españoles más creativos del mundo de los negocios» según la revista Forbes. Actualmente, es miembro del Consejo Internacional de la San Telmo Business School y preside el Consejo Asesor de la Fundación Scholas para Panamá, Centroamérica y Caribe.
